HTML PDF API features and specs

  • Ease of Use
    HTML PDF API provides a straightforward interface for converting HTML content to PDFs, making it accessible for developers of all skill levels.
  • High-Quality Output
    The service generates high-fidelity PDF documents that accurately capture the design and functionality of the original HTML.
  • Customization
    Offers extensive customization options, including the ability to set page size, margins, headers, footers, and custom CSS.
  • API Integration
    Easily integrates with various programming languages and environments through RESTful API calls, enhancing its versatility in different projects.
  • Cloud-Based Service
    Being a cloud-based service, it eliminates the need for local installations and maintenance, reducing the burden on local resources.
  • Security
    Supports HTTPS, ensuring that data transmitted to and from the service is encrypted and secure.

Possible disadvantages of HTML PDF API

  • Cost
    Depending on your usage, HTML PDF API can become expensive, particularly for large-scale operations requiring high volume or premium features.
  • Dependency on Internet Connectivity
    Being a cloud-based service, it requires a stable internet connection, which can be a limitation in environments with poor connectivity.
  • Latency
    Network latency can affect the speed of PDF generation, which may impact time-sensitive applications.
  • Rate Limiting
    Usage may be subject to rate limiting, potentially hindering the performance of high-demand applications or requiring additional cost to increase limits.
  • Privacy Concerns
    Sensitive data needs to be transmitted to a third-party server for processing, which could raise privacy and compliance concerns depending on jurisdiction and data sensitivity.
  • Potential Downtime
    As with any cloud-based service, there is a risk of downtime or service disruptions due to server issues or maintenance.

getPDFapi features and specs

  • Ease of Use
    getPDFapi offers a user-friendly interface and straightforward API, making it accessible for developers to integrate into their applications with minimal effort.
  • High-Quality Output
    The API generates high-quality PDF documents, ensuring that the resulting files meet professional standards in terms of appearance and formatting.
  • Comprehensive Documentation
    getPDFapi provides detailed documentation and examples, which makes it easier for developers to understand and implement the service in their projects.
  • Customizability
    The API allows for extensive customization options, enabling developers to tailor the PDF output according to specific needs.
  • Fast Processing
    The service offers quick processing times, allowing users to generate PDFs rapidly, which is beneficial for applications requiring real-time document generation.

Possible disadvantages of getPDFapi

  • Cost
    Depending on the usage level, the service can become expensive, which might not be suitable for small businesses or individual developers with limited budgets.
  • Limited Free Tier
    The free tier of getPDFapi offers limited usage, which may not be sufficient for users who need to generate a large number of PDFs regularly.
  • Dependency on Third-Party Service
    Relying on an external API means potential risks related to service outages or changes, which could affect the availability and functionality of the application using it.
  • Internet Connectivity Requirement
    The API requires Internet access to function, which could be a limitation for applications that need to operate offline.
  • Security Concerns
    Using an online service for PDF generation might raise security concerns, especially if sensitive data is being processed.
